C

Espressifボードのフラッシュ手順

デモ・イメージをEspressifボードにフラッシュする前に、Espressif IoT Development Framework(ESP-IDF)をインストールして設定する。ESP-IDFのインストールと設定が完了したら、USBケーブルを使用してボードをホストPCに接続します。

以下の手順に従って、ボードにアプリケーションをフラッシュします:

  1. 環境変数を設定します。
    . $HOME/esp/esp-idf/export.sh

    ESP-IDFコマンドプロンプトまたはESP-IDF PowerShell環境を起動します。

  2. ESP-IDFフラッシングツールを実行します:
    python -m esptool --chip esp32s3 -b 460800 --before default_reset --after hard_reset write_flash --flash_mode dio --flash_size 16MB --flash_freq 80m 0x8000 <PATH_PARTITION_TABLE>/partition-table.bin 0x10000 <PATH_TO_BINARY>/your_binary.bin
    python -m esptool --chip esp32s3 -b 460800 --before default_reset --after hard_reset write_flash --flash_mode dio --flash_size 16MB --flash_freq 80m 0x8000 <PATH_PARTITION_TABLE>\partition-table.bin 0x10000 <PATH_TO_BINARY>\your_binary.bin

    フラッシュプロセスが完了すると、デバイス上でアプリケーションが動作しているのが確認できるはずです。画面が空白の場合は、ここに記載されている手順に従って、ブートローダ・イメージをフラッシュしていることを確認してください。


詳細はこちらをご覧ください。